首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Tic tac toe游戏:当我点击方块时,如何将值添加到数组中

Tic Tac Toe游戏是一种经典的井字棋游戏,玩家通过点击棋盘上的方块来进行游戏。当玩家点击方块时,需要将对应的值添加到一个数组中来表示棋盘的状态。

在前端开发中,可以通过以下步骤将值添加到数组中:

  1. 创建一个表示棋盘状态的数组,可以使用一维或二维数组来表示。假设使用一维数组来表示棋盘,长度为9。
  2. 在HTML中设置好棋盘的布局,可以使用HTML表格或div元素来创建九个方块,并给每个方块添加一个点击事件。
  3. 在JavaScript中,为每个方块的点击事件绑定相应的处理函数。当方块被点击时,触发处理函数。
  4. 处理函数中,首先获取被点击方块的位置信息,可以使用索引或自定义属性来表示方块的位置。然后判断当前点击的方块是否为空,即数组中对应位置的值是否为空。
  5. 如果方块为空,将当前玩家的值(一般是"X"或"O")添加到数组的对应位置。可以使用数组的splice()方法或直接赋值来实现。
  6. 根据游戏规则判断游戏是否结束,例如是否出现三个相同的值在一行、一列或一条对角线上。可以编写相应的判断函数来检查数组中的值。
  7. 如果游戏结束,可以展示获胜者或平局的提示信息,并禁用方块的点击事件。

需要注意的是,以上只是实现Tic Tac Toe游戏中将值添加到数组的基本步骤。在实际开发中,还需要考虑各种异常情况的处理,如输入验证、界面更新等。

推荐的腾讯云相关产品:由于不提及具体云计算品牌商,可以参考腾讯云的云开发产品,如云函数(https://cloud.tencent.com/product/scf)和云数据库(https://cloud.tencent.com/product/cdb)等,来实现游戏逻辑和数据存储的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券